>I just checked the SPYCRAFT LITE rules (version 1.1), and it is stated
>on the Credit & License page (2) that the VP/WP system is not OGC.

No, you think it says that -- but it doesn't.

It states: "Vitality points, wounds, and other rules from the STAR WARS 
roleplaying game not covered by the Open Gaming License used with permission 
from Wizards of the Coast."

Which is all well and good: AEG needed permission to use the material in 
their product.

But on pg. 286 of the rulebook, that content -- as it appears in SPYCRAFT -- 
is designated as OGC. It is not closed. It is not designated as IP.
